Symptoms of Hyperhidrosis (Sticky Skin Disease)

The name of this disease is self-explanatory. However, a patient with the condition may experience one or more of the following symptoms:

  • Excessive sweating beyond what’s needed to maintain the body’s normal temperature
  • Sweating even in cold climates or without any physical exertion
  • Moist or wet palms, soles, underarms, and even the face
  • Noticeable sweat stains on the clothes
  • Having a slippery grip or difficulty handling objects due to sweaty hands
  • Skin maceration that is, soaking excess moisture in the affected area, leading to softening of the skin
  • Irritation in the affected area due to constant moisture
  • Episodes of abnormal sweating lasting minutes or hours, generally occurring daily

The symptoms may also vary from one person to another. In some, the symptoms can be more localized, while in others, the whole body may be affected.

Hyperhidrosis: The Cause

There is no single reason or cause, and Hyperhidrosis can be caused by a number of different factors. Depending upon the type, Hyperhidrosis can be:

Idiopathic or Primary hyperhidrosis and

Secondary hyperhidrosis.

Primary Hyperhidrosis: Primary or idiopathic Hyperhidrosis can have one or more of the following underlying factors:

  • Overactive sympathetic nervous system, the one that is responsible for the body’s fight or flight response
  • Age: the problem is found to start in childhood or adolescence
  • Heredity that is, family history, though not confirmed

Secondary Hyperhidrosis: This type is generally caused by an underlying health condition, like:

  • A hormonal imbalance, like in the case of hyperthyroidism, menopause, etc.
  • An infection or fever
  • A metabolic disorder, like diabetes (high blood sugar) or low blood sugar
  • Antidepressants, painkillers and other medications
  • Being obese or overweight
  • Cardiovascular, that is, heart disorders
  • Anxiety and stress

How to Diagnose ‘Sticky Skin Disease’ (Hyperhidrosis)?

In addition to visual inspection and assessing patient history, several diagnostic tests can be performed to confirm the presence of Hyperhidrosis.

  • Starch-Iodine Test: In this test iodine solution is applied to the skin. After the solution has dried, the lab technician sprinkles starch powder over the area. If the person is sweating, the moisture will react with the iodine-starch combination and turn the affected area purple or dark blue. This color change helps with visual mapping the location and severity of sweating, confirming Hyperhidrosis. This also gives a near-precise idea of the area where the treatment needs to be targeted.
  • Gravimetric Test: This specialized test measures the exact amount of sweat produced during a time period and uses pre-weighed filter paper.
  • Thermoregulatory Sweat Test: A special powder is applied to the person’s body, which changes color as the person sweats. This person would be placed in a warm, humid environment to reveal overall sweating patterns across his/her body.
  • Minor’s Test: This is a variation of the Starch-Iodine Test and is used to map the sweating of the person before a procedure like Botox treatment or surgery.
  • Questionnaires: Hyperhidrosis Disease Severity Scale or HDSS is a set of questions to be answered by the tested person and helps understand how excessive sweating impacts daily activities and life of the person.

Conventional Treatments Vs. Homeopathy For Sticky Skin Syndrome (Hyperhidrosis)

The conventional approach to treating Hyperhidrosis includes suppressing the excessive sweating by the means of:

  • Antiperspirants – medications that stop or reduce sweating
  • Oral medicines that reduce the activity of the sweat glands
  • Botox injections to block nerve signals in the affected area
  • Surgical procedures, like sympathectomy – for severe cases

Though these medications and methods may seem to be working quickly, they rarely offer a lasting solution. Additionally, there is always a greater risk of side effects, like skin irritation, compensatory sweating, and dryness of mouth.
